The South Africa's most-loved Maskandi artist Khuzani Mpungose won his first-prestigious international award during HAPA Awards ceremony in Los Angeles,USA.
Khuzani also became the first South African artist for Maskandi genre to be given a spotlight in the international event such as Hollywood and African Prestigious Awards, and was announced as a winner of Best Independent Male Artist(African).
His victory in the foreign land far away from home has signified his undisputed title as the King of Maskandi music, the genre which is loved and followed by millions of people beyond South Africa.
Khuzani has won almost every award in South Africa during fifteen years of his illustrious career as a professional artist, and in total he had won 23 awards including the HAPA award.

Khuzani's background
He was born and bred at Mandaba area which follows under Nkandla Local Municipality in KwaZulu-Natal province, he was raised by his own paternal grandmother Cagwe after his parents died when he was a teenager.
He rose to fame in 2009 after he was invited by the owner of Izingane Zoma Music,Shobeni Khuzwayo,to complete the late Mgqumeni's album iSecret.
He released his debut studio album Bahluleke Bonke in 2011,and that album won Best Selling Album at the Amantshontsho ka Maskandi Awards.
